BDB1292
בּוֺקֵר noun masculine denominative herdsman Amos 7:14 of Amos himself, compare אֲשֶׁרהָֿיָה בַּנֹּקְדִים Amos 1:1.

| Strong's Number: | H951 |
|---|---|
| Word: | בּוֹקֵר |
| Part of Speech: | noun masc |
| Etymology: | (properly) active participle from H1239 as denominative from H1241 |
| Language: | Hebrew |
| Occurrences: | 1 |
| Transliteration: | bowker |
| Phonetic Spelling/Pronunciation: | bo-kare' |
| Meaning: | 1. a cattle-tender |
| KJV Renderings: | herdman. |
